Intensified Total Neoadjuvant Therapy in Patients With Locally Advanced Rectal Cancer: A Phase II Trial.
F De Felice1, G D'Ambrosio2, F Iafrate3
1Department of Radiotherapy, Policlinico Umberto I "Sapienza" University of Rome, Rome, Italy.
Summary
This study evaluated total neoadjuvant therapy for locally advanced rectal cancer, combining targeted agents with FOLFOXIRI chemotherapy and chemoradiotherapy. The treatment demonstrated promising efficacy and safety, with a high pathological complete response rate and good tolerability.
Area of Science:
- Oncology
- Gastroenterology
- Surgical Oncology
Background:
- Locally advanced rectal cancer (LARC) requires effective treatment strategies.
- Neoadjuvant therapy aims to improve surgical outcomes and reduce recurrence.
- Optimizing neoadjuvant regimens is crucial for enhancing patient response and survival.
Purpose of the Study:
- To assess the efficacy and safety of total neoadjuvant therapy (TNT) in LARC patients.
- To evaluate a regimen combining targeted agents with FOLFOXIRI induction chemotherapy, followed by chemoradiotherapy (CRT) and surgery.
- To determine the pathological complete response (pCR) rate and other clinical outcomes.
Main Methods:
- A single-arm, single-centre phase II clinical trial was conducted.
- Patients received induction chemotherapy with FOLFOXIRI plus either bevacizumab (mutated Ras-BRAF) or panitumumab/cetuximab (wild-type Ras-BRAF).
- This was followed by intensified oxaliplatin-5-fluorouracil-based CRT and surgical resection.
Main Results:
- Twenty-eight LARC patients were enrolled; 92.9% completed the planned TNT strategy.
- A pathological complete response (pCR) was observed in 32.1% of patients, with an additional 7.2% achieving near-pCR.
- The regimen was well-tolerated, with no febrile neutropenia or grade 4 adverse events reported. All patients underwent radical resection.
Conclusions:
- Total neoadjuvant therapy combining FOLFOXIRI, targeted agents, and intensified CRT shows promising clinical activity in LARC.
- The treatment regimen is well-tolerated and achieves high rates of pathological response and complete resection.
- This phase II study supports further investigation in phase III trials for LARC management.
